AI-Driven Mix Design Revolutionizing Concrete Performance

The self-compacting concrete market is undergoing digital transformation through AI-enabled mix optimization. In March 2026, major producers including Cemex and Holcim deployed AI-driven tools to refine SCC formulations in real time. These systems adjust superplasticizers and viscosity-modifying agents (VMAs) based on local aggregate variations, ensuring consistent flowability without segregation. This innovation enhances quality control and supports the use of diverse raw materials in complex construction environments.

Sustainable SCC Formulations Supporting Green Infrastructure

Sustainability mandates are driving the adoption of eco-friendly SCC compositions in large-scale construction projects. Between 2025 and 2026, companies such as Sika and Heidelberg Materials incorporated up to 30% recycled aggregates and ground glass fillers into SCC mixes. These formulations are aligned with green building certifications and are particularly suited for infrastructure projects requiring high reinforcement density. The ability of SCC to flow without mechanical vibration reduces energy consumption and labor requirements, supporting sustainable construction practices.

Expansion of Ready-Mix Facilities for High-Performance Concrete

Capacity expansion in ready-mix concrete facilities is enabling the broader adoption of SCC and ultra-high-performance concrete (UHPC). Saint-Gobain announced the expansion of its specialized RMC facilities in North America. These units are optimized for advanced concrete formulations, supporting automated pouring techniques for complex architectural structures such as columns and high-density reinforcements. The shift toward automated and labor-efficient construction methods is reinforcing demand for SCC in modern infrastructure development.
